Dr. John C. Dolan joins Central Park West Orthodontics, bringing advanced expertise and compassionate care to patients seeking a trusted orthodontist in New York.

NEW YORK - Nyenta -- Central Park West welcomes a new leader in orthodontic care with the addition of Dr. John C. Dolan to one of Manhattan's most distinguished practices. With a reputation for combining clinical precision with a patient-first approach, Dr. Dolan joins Central Park West Orthodontics to enhance the practice's mission of delivering confident, healthy smiles across all ages.

Known for his expertise in advanced orthodontic treatments and a commitment to individualized care, Dr. Dolan brings fresh perspective and years of experience to the Upper West Side. His approach focuses on both the science and the art of orthodontics—creating not just properly aligned teeth, but natural, aesthetically pleasing results.

"Joining a practice so dedicated to excellence and innovation in orthodontics is an exciting step," said Dr. Dolan. "My goal is to help each patient feel seen, understood, and empowered throughout their journey to a better smile."
